Как экспортировать настольное приложение с ионным и электронным? - PullRequest
0 голосов
/ 03 сентября 2018

Я создаю настольное приложение с Ionic 3 и Electron .

Ионная версия: 3.9.2

электронная версия: 2.0.7

Когда я запускаю команду для экспорта приложения Windows, я получаю эту ошибку:

команда запуска:

электрон-строитель

версия для электроники = 20.28.1

загруженный файл конфигурации = package.json (поле "build")

запись эффективного конфигурационного файла = dist \ builder -ffective-config.yaml

Error: Unresolved node modules: core-js at C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\util\packageDependencies.ts:108:17 From previous event: at Collector.resolveUnresolvedHoisted (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\util\packageDependencies.ts:164:10) at C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\util\packageDependencies.ts:82:28 at Generator.next (<anonymous>) at runCallback (timers.js:789:20) at tryOnImmediate (timers.js:751:5) at processImmediate [as _immediateCallback] (timers.js:722:5) From previous event: at Collector.collect (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\util\packageDependencies.ts:84:6) at C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\out\util\packageDependencies.js:123:47 at Generator.next (<anonymous>) From previous event: at getProductionDependencies (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\out\util\packageDependencies.js:128:17) at Lazy.<anonymous> (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\packager.ts:112:24) at Generator.next (<anonymous>) From previous event: at Lazy.get value [as value] (C:\Users\Mohammad\Documents\Project\poker\node_modules\lazy-val\src\main.ts:18:23) at C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\util\yarn.ts:128:81 at Generator.next (<anonymous>) From previous event: at rebuild (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\out\util\yarn.js:239:18) at C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\util\yarn.ts:20:11 at Generator.next (<anonymous>) at runCallback (timers.js:789:20) at tryOnImmediate (timers.js:751:5) at processImmediate [as _immediateCallback] (timers.js:722:5) From previous event: at installOrRebuild (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\out\util\yarn.js:68:17) at C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\packager.ts:457:13 at Generator.next (<anonymous>) From previous event: at Packager.installAppDependencies (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\packager.ts:418:70) at C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\packager.ts:368:20 at Generator.next (<anonymous>) From previous event: at Packager.doBuild (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\packager.ts:344:39) at C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\packager.ts:314:57 at Generator.next (<anonymous>) at C:\Users\Mohammad\Documents\Project\poker\node_modules\graceful-fs\graceful-fs.js:99:16 at C:\Users\Mohammad\Documents\Project\poker\node_modules\graceful-fs\graceful-fs.js:43:10 at FSReqWrap.oncomplete (fs.js:135:15) From previous event: at Packager._build (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\packager.ts:285:133) at C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\packager.ts:281:23 at Generator.next (<anonymous>) From previous event: at Packager.build (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\packager.ts:238:14) at build (C:\Users\Mohammad\Documents\Project\poker\node_modules\app-builder-lib\src\index.ts:58:28) at build (C:\Users\Mohammad\Documents\Project\poker\node_modules\electron-builder\src\builder.ts:227:10) at then (C:\Users\Mohammad\Documents\Project\poker\node_modules\electron-builder\src\cli\cli.ts:42:48) at runCallback (timers.js:789:20) at tryOnImmediate (timers.js:751:5) at processImmediate [as _immediateCallback] (timers.js:722:5) From previous event: at Object.args [as handler] (C:\Users\Mohammad\Documents\Project\poker\node_modules\electron-builder\src\cli\cli.ts:42:48) at Object.runCommand (C:\Users\Mohammad\Documents\Project\poker\node_modules\electron-builder\node_modules\yargs\lib\command.js:237:44) at Object.parseArgs [as _parseArgs] (C:\Users\Mohammad\Documents\Project\poker\node_modules\electron-builder\node_modules\yargs\yargs.js:1085:24) at Object.get [as argv] (C:\Users\Mohammad\Documents\Project\poker\node_modules\electron-builder\node_modules\yargs\yargs.js:1000:21) at Object.<anonymous> (C:\Users\Mohammad\Documents\Project\poker\node_modules\electron-builder\src\cli\cli.ts:25:28) at Module._compile (module.js:635:30) at Object.Module._extensions..js (module.js:646:10) at Module.load (module.js:554:32) at tryModuleLoad (module.js:497:12) at Function.Module._load (module.js:489:3) at Function.Module.runMain (module.js:676:10) at startup (bootstrap_node.js:187:16) at bootstrap_node.js:608:3 npm ERR! code ELIFECYCLE npm ERR! errno 1 npm ERR! persis-poker@0.0.1 dist: electron-builder npm ERR! Exit status 1 npm ERR! npm ERR! Failed at the persis-poker@0.0.1 dist script. npm ERR! This is probably not a problem with npm. There is likely additional logging output above. npm ERR! A complete log of this run can be found in: npm ERR! C:\Users\Mohammad\AppData\Roaming\npm-cache\_logs\2018-09-03T08_52_39_783Z-debug.log

...